Undernutrition and growth restriction due to poor diet and inadequate nutrient intake continues to be a global challenge, particularly in the developing countries including Uganda. The etiology of inadequate nutrient supply to infants may relate to lack of resources or knowledge or a combination of both. Poor nutrient intake and impaired growth may affect brain and cognitive development.
This study aims to evaluate nutrient intake, growth and cognitive function among children between 6 and 36 months living in the fertile Kabale and Kisoro region in south-western Uganda. The investigators hypothesize that nutrition education to mothers can bring about improved dietary intake and nutritional status among children aged 6-36 months.
A follow-up study was conducted during the period January - July 2022.
